Other Comments: The Four Mints is a seasoned, fun and entertaining Rhythm & Blues band based in Columbus, Ohio. Originally formed by the legendary James Brown in the 1960’s, The Four Mints is currently led by one of the group’s original members, bass/keyboardist Aaron Sledge.

The Four Mints consists of four vocalists and three instrumental musicians who play guitar, drums and bass/keyboard. One of Columbus’s genuine musical treasures, The Four Mints are renowned for their rich storehouse of songs from the 50s through the 90s, including Motown, doo-wop, dance, funk, and oldies.
This talented and fun group has been influenced by the music of Marvin Gaye, The O’Jays, The Temptations, Earth Wind & Fire, The Spinners, The Four Tops, The Drifters, and Babyface.
